Company overview

USG Insurance Services, Inc. is a national wholesale broker and managing general agent (MGA) that provides innovative insurance solutions for hard-to-place commercial insurance coverages. They generate revenue by partnering with retail agents to offer specialty insurance products and underwriting services, leveraging their extensive market relationships and expertise. Founded in 2001, USG has grown significantly, expanding its footprint across the United States with multiple branch locations, and is known for its commitment to service excellence and customized insurance solutions.
